Web(i) The Nazis could not get popularity till the early 1930s. It was during the Great Depression that Nazism became a mass movement. (ii) After 1929, banks collapsed and businesses shutdown, workers lost their jobs and the middle classes were threatened with destitution. In such a situation, Nazi propaganda stirred hopes of a better future. WebDuring the Great Depression, Nazism became a mass movement. At the time of this … WebThe Holocaust was not a single event.
